    As I mentioned before in another thread: Just edit C:\Dokumente und Einstellungen\Jens_Profil\Application Data\hdl_dump.conf to something like:

    "disc_database_file" = "C:\\Dokumente und Einstellungen\\Jens_Profil\\Application Data\\hdl_dump.list"
    "enable_aspi" = "yes"
    "last_ip" = "192.168.1.9"
    "limit_to_28bit" = "yes"
    "partition_naming" = "standard"
    "udp_delay_time" = "4"
    "udp_quick_packets" = "15"

    "use_compression" = "no"

    and you get transfer speed round about 2.1Mb with original versin 8.3

    It's located at "C:\Documents and Settings\<username>\Application Data\hdl_dump.conf". Where <username> is of course substituted with your login name to windows.

    If this location is hidden on your system, then you can still type it in manually in the windows explorer address bar as long as you know the login name. You can also set windows explorer to show all hidden files. From windows explorer, navigate to "Tools" > "Folder Options..." > "View" (tab), and then click on "Show hidden files and folders" and click "OK" or "Apply". This will allow you to see any hidden files on your system.

    I think this modified version of hdl_dumb is more superior than the official release verion 'cause with this version it also has the option to extract the game from PS2 HD to PC via the network without connecting the PS2 HD directly to the PC (this is one great feature). If you just go to 'Edit and Delete' right click on the game name and you'll see the option to 'Extract', I already tried it and the speed for extracting is about 1.3mbps.
